Alegre Home Care receives consistently positive remarks about the quality and bedside manner of its caregivers. Many families highlight compassionate, respectful, and professional aides who provide companionship, prompt personal-care assistance, medication reminders, walks, and engagement activities. Several comments point to long-term matches and improved daily routines for clients, and reviewers note that the agency enforces screening and safety protocols, including infection-control practices. Caregiver support and a generally positive workplace culture are also emphasized, which appears to contribute to staff retention and continuity of care in some cases.
Office-level strengths include responsive supervisors and an attentive administrative staff. Multiple reviewers praised quick start times, flexible scheduling, and accommodation of short-notice changes. Daily reporting and open communication about care plans are mentioned as reassuring features for families. The agency is also described as supportive of caregivers, with on-time pay and internal resources that help maintain staff engagement.
Operationally, however, patterns of inconsistent reliability emerge. Several reviewers described late arrivals, no-shows, and last-minute cancellations or shift changes without immediate replacement; these incidents point to gaps in shift-coverage protocols and contingency staffing. Relatedly, some families experienced poor follow-up or delayed callbacks from the office, indicating opportunities to strengthen communication workflows and client-facing responsiveness.
There are also occasional concerns about caregiver matching and skills alignment. A few accounts mention caregivers who lacked particular experience, language proficiency, or comfort with specific client needs, suggesting room to refine assignment processes and skill-based matching. Value perceptions are mixed: some clients find the agency competitively priced and worth the cost, while others characterize pricing as high and would prefer clearer billing terms or alternative fee structures. Clarifying cancellation-fee policies and enhancing billing transparency may reduce frustration.
Overall, Alegre Home Care's principal strengths are in caregiver compassion, person-centered engagement, and an administrative team capable of rapid starts and flexible scheduling. The most noticeable operational weaknesses are reliability of shift coverage, punctuality, and occasional gaps in office communication and caregiver-client matching. Prospective clients who prioritize warm, attentive caregiving and who can plan around potential last-minute staffing adjustments are likely to have a positive experience; families with strict punctuality or language/skill requirements should discuss assignment and contingency policies with the office up front.
